移动云直播平台如何应对流量高峰?
随着互联网技术的飞速发展,移动云直播平台在近年来得到了广泛的关注和应用。然而,随着用户数量的不断增长,如何应对流量高峰成为了一个亟待解决的问题。本文将从以下几个方面探讨移动云直播平台如何应对流量高峰。
一、优化网络架构
- 多级缓存机制
在移动云直播平台中,多级缓存机制可以有效降低服务器压力,提高用户观看体验。具体来说,可以将内容分为热点数据和冷点数据,对热点数据进行缓存,减少对服务器资源的占用。
- 负载均衡技术
通过负载均衡技术,可以将用户请求分配到不同的服务器上,从而提高服务器处理能力。常用的负载均衡技术有轮询、最少连接数、IP哈希等。
- 分布式存储
采用分布式存储技术,可以将数据分散存储在多个服务器上,提高数据读写速度,降低单点故障风险。
二、提升内容分发效率
- CDN加速
通过CDN(内容分发网络)技术,可以将内容分发到全球各地的节点,降低用户访问延迟。同时,CDN可以根据用户地理位置,智能选择最优节点,提高观看体验。
- 直播推流优化
在直播推流过程中,可以通过优化编码、调整码率等方式,降低带宽占用,提高传输效率。
- 直播切片技术
直播切片技术可以将直播内容切割成多个小片段,用户可以根据自己的需求下载观看,降低服务器压力。
三、加强运维管理
- 实时监控
通过实时监控系统,可以及时发现并处理服务器、网络、带宽等方面的异常情况,确保平台稳定运行。
- 预警机制
建立预警机制,对可能出现的问题进行提前预警,以便及时采取措施,避免流量高峰对平台造成严重影响。
- 应急预案
制定应急预案,针对不同情况下的流量高峰,采取相应的应对措施,确保平台稳定运行。
四、拓展合作渠道
- 与运营商合作
与运营商合作,共同优化网络环境,提高用户观看体验。例如,可以与运营商合作推出专属流量包,降低用户观看直播时的流量消耗。
- 与内容提供商合作
与内容提供商合作,丰富直播内容,吸引更多用户。同时,可以通过内容提供商的资源优势,提高内容分发效率。
- 与第三方平台合作
与第三方平台合作,拓展用户群体,提高平台知名度。例如,可以与社交媒体、短视频平台等合作,实现资源共享。
五、持续优化用户体验
- 个性化推荐
根据用户喜好,为用户提供个性化的直播内容推荐,提高用户粘性。
- 互动功能
增加直播间的互动功能,如弹幕、礼物等,提高用户参与度。
- 优化界面设计
优化直播平台的界面设计,提高用户使用体验。
总之,移动云直播平台应对流量高峰需要从多个方面入手,包括优化网络架构、提升内容分发效率、加强运维管理、拓展合作渠道以及持续优化用户体验等。通过这些措施,可以有效应对流量高峰,为用户提供优质、稳定的直播服务。
猜你喜欢:私有化部署IM